    Johnstone (Scots: Johnstoun, [2] Scottish Gaelic: Baile Iain) [3] is a town in the administrative area of Renfrewshire and larger historic county of the same name, in the west central Lowlands of Scotland.. The town lies 3 miles (5 km) west of neighbouring Paisley, 12 miles (19 km) west of the centre of the city of Glasgow and 12 miles (19 km) north east of Kilwinning. [4]

  4. Visit Johnstone. The town’s main industry was cotton thread. Mills were powered by the Black Cart Water to the north of Johnstone. A six-storey cotton mill, one of the largest in Scotland, was built in 1782. You can explore the history of the town in the excellent Johnstone History Museum. The museum is located within Morrison’s supermarket.

Although by no means an exhaustive list, Johnstone’s footballing exports include long-tenured international goalkeeper Jim Leighton as well as Tommy Bryce, Tommy Turner, John “Dixie” Deans and history-making defender William Clunas, who played in the first ever clash between Scotland and “the auld enemy” of England at Wembley stadium.
